Juniper Carpet vs Pacific Flying Fox
Thera juniperata compared with Pteropus tonganus
Taxonomic Classification
| Rank | Juniper Carpet | Pacific Flying Fox |
|---|---|---|
| Kingdom same | Animalia (Animals) | Animalia (Animals) |
| Phylum | Arthropoda (Arthropods) | Chordata (Chordates) |
| Class | Insecta (Insects) | Mammalia (Mammals) |
| Order | Lepidoptera (Butterflies & Moths) | Chiroptera (Bats) |
| Family | Geometridae | Pteropodidae (Fruit Bats) |
| Genus | Thera | Pteropus (Flying Foxes) |
| Species | Thera juniperata | Pteropus tonganus |
